Human Rights Commissioners named [May 19, 2006 -11.30 GMT]

President Mahinda Rajapaksa appointed five new Commissioners to the Human Rights (HRC) Commission yesterday. Deshamanya P. Ramanadan, former Justice of the Supreme Court was appointed as Chairman.

D. Jayawickrema, S. G. Punchihewa, Nalani Abeywardena and M.T.M Basik are the rest of the members.

The HRC of Sri Lanka started work in 1997 under the Human Rights Commission Act No. 21 of 1996. It combined the functions of two other institutions which preceded it– the Commission for Elimination of Discrimination and Monitoring of Human Rights and the Human Rights Task Force. The Commission however is vested with additional powers and responsibilities.
